Mission
Dedicated to preservation, restoration and appreciation of our natural world. It owns approximately 1500 acres of land in afton, west lakeland township and lakeland, mn. Belwin comprises one of the largest privately owned natural preserves in the twin cities region with a focus on connecting people and the natural world.
Programs
1 program
Art, science and nature - belwin provides high quality, diverse art (and science) programming, both participatory and observatory that will in all cases include an environmental message that leaves participants delighted with the experience and enlightened to environmental issues.
